Tina Fey Responds to Tracy’s Homophobic Rant, “He’s too self-centered to ever hurt another person.”

I’m not going to regurgitate a story that you’ve heard a million times. The short and dirty is that Tracy Morgan made some gay jokes that seemed to go too far. Friday, he apologized and today, his ’30-Rock’ co-star, Tina Fey released a statement.
“The violent imagery of Tracy’s rant was disturbing to me at a time when homophobic hate crimes continue to be a life-threatening issue for the GLBT Community. It also doesn’t line up with the Tracy Morgan I know, who is not a hateful man and is generally much too sleepy and self-centered to ever hurt another person. I hope for his sake that Tracy’s apology will be accepted as sincere by his gay and lesbian co-workers at ’30 Rock’, without whom Tracy would not have lines to say, clothes to wear, sets to stand on, scene partners to act with, or a printed-out paycheck from accounting to put in his pocket.”
